What Was Leaked?

Leak, which surfaced on highly visited websites such as Reddit and Twitter, contains high definition renders and fan-favorite skin concept art which include:

  • Spider-Man – It’s a dark, cyberpunk-themed costume that includes glowing eyes and armor plating.
  • Iron Man – A “War-Torn” version that contains war-damage, exposed systems, and dark-metal paint.
  • Storm – A gold-embellished, majestic costume that suits her comic book goddess look.
  • Loki – A high-tech trickster costume that fuses old-style Norse clothing and current powers.

Although NetEase hasn’t commented about these skins officially, several trustworthy sources, including dataminers who have experienced the game’s closed beta, have proven their existence.

How are Marvel Rivals?

If little is known about the title, Marvel Rivals will be a 6v6 PvP shooter that will combine combo-style hero action, worlds that are destructible, and team strategy in one. NetEase game developers have created it in close collaboration with Marvel Games, and they will have characters of all of Marvel multiverse. It will have its focus on PC and console systems.

Its early this year closed alpha received overall wonderful reception, most prominently for its smooth pace, explosive team fights, and high production values. Its ultimate beta should also surface later in 2025.
